Abstract
In this contemporary world, robotics has been fast growing and interesting field. The process of collaborating the robot’s intelligence with the internet of things will yield a useful product to mankind. This paper talks about one such output which is a robot car. The main motivation for this design is to allow the car to navigate in an unknown environment by avoiding collisions and manual control using a Bluetooth mobile app. A robot is a machine that can perform tasks automatically or with guidance. The project proposes a robotic vehicle with intelligence built into it to guide itself whenever an obstacle comes ahead of it. And, we can control steering manually by mobile phone.
